On 28/10/2014 15:58, David wrote:
> Is there any way to turn off the auto compile feature?
> It seems that when I make changes in the editor & test run  - the auto compiled code runs instead - often after I immediately compile my newly edited file -  or delete the compiled versions of code in advance.

It sounds like you're experiencing something mentioned a while ago, that
when a code file is re-compiled then the copy of the previous version of
the object code, lodged in memory, is not necessarily replaced by the
newly-compiled version.

Re-starting PLUS should clear it but that is massively inconvenient.

Which version of PLUS are you using?
